WebThe Moravian Graveyards of Lititz, Pa., 1744–1905 By Abraham Reinke Beck Originally published in 1906 within the Transactions of the Moravian Historical Society, this volume contains the names, gravesite locations, and available personal details for 1,219 people interred at the Moravian graveyard in Lititz, Pennsylvania, between 1758 and 1905.
